Blood analysis and testing equipments are used for analyzing the different components
of blood. They are used to maintain the quality of blood components and separate
various components too. Here are listed some of the equipments which are used for
blood testing and analysis.

Platelet Agitator

Platelet agitators maintain donor platelets in an even suspension throughout the blood plasma.
Platelet agitators are used for storing platelets at a specified temperature range usually
between 20°C-24°C. Blood platelets must be kept agitated in order to retain their adhesive
properties and viability. Platelet agitators are of two types: Flatbed type of agitator
and Rotary type of agitator. In flatbed type agitators the agitation achieved is better
than in rotary types of agitators. Platelet agitators are found as a free standing unit
in an air conditioned room and they can be fitted inside an incubator too, which achieves
the desired temperature.
Platelet agitators are needed in blood banks and hospitals to ensure proper storage of
platelets before transfusion. The main function of a platelet agitator is to store
platelet concentrates in continuous motion at a specified temperature. It is a chamber
like structure made of double wall. The exterior one is made of mild steel while the
inner portion is made from imported medical grade stainless steel.
Platelet agitators are of differing sizes and designs. They are required to be robust
and emit low noise because continuous agitation is needed. They do no damage to blood
cells. They can be accommodated in platelet incubators.
Plasma Expressor

Plasma expressor is an electromechanical device used in hospital blood banks and
research laboratories for automatic separation of plasma from whole blood. The
conventional separators use a simple mechanical process that requires the operator
to monitor the process continuously. When separation has completed the tubing is
closed precisely. While in plasma expressors, an optical sensor is used to signal
the electronic clamp to close when the first red cells are detected.
Plasma Thawing Bath

Plasma thawing baths are used in hospital blood banks and clinical & research
laboratories. Plasma thawing baths are used to thaw frozen plasma with the
minimum user intervention. A high capacity circulation system and a high quality temperature controller are the
main components of any plasma thawing bath. Plasma packets are held in plastic pockets
that are clipped into the bath. The packs are quickly defrosted or brought to 37°C.
Cryoprecipitate Bath

Cryoprecipitate baths are essential for all blood banks and transfusion centers.
They are used for safe and reliable plasma thawing. Cryoprecipitate baths have
a crucial role in transfusion. Now-a-days cryoprecipitate baths are available
with different accessories to suit different lab procedures & settings. They
have microprocessor based temperature control units. They have audio-visual
alarms, which start beeping if temperature deviates from its preset value.
They consist of smooth acrylic tray for accommodating plasma bags. Cryoprecipitate
baths are also known as cryo bath.
